Key Responsibilities: Live and breathe the Pacvac brand and act as a custodian of our brand guidelines. Conduct user research to understand user needs, behaviors, and pain points through surveys, interviews, and usability testing. Create user personas to represent ideal users based on research and guide design decisions. Develop information architecture to organize and structure content for easy navigation and findability. Design moodboards, wireframes, and prototypes to create low-fidelity and high-fidelity representations of the user interface. Design visually appealing and intuitive user interfaces that meet user needs and business goals. Conduct usability testing to evaluate the user experience and identify areas for improvement. Collaborate with developers to ensure the design is implemented correctly. Stay up-to-date with industry trends, technologies, and best practices. Create assets for social media, collateral, digital, eDM, and sales using UI design principles. Utilize project management skills to manage design projects effectively. Run surveys periodically with online customers to improve conversion rates and help achieve KPI targets. Apply a data-led approach to improve UI and UX on all our websites and apps.
